diff --git a/Documentation/config/commitgraph.txt b/Documentation/config/commitgraph.txt deleted file mode 100644 index 7f8c9d6638..0000000000 --- a/Documentation/config/commitgraph.txt +++ /dev/null @@ -1,37 +0,0 @@ -commitGraph.generationVersion:: - Specifies the type of generation number version to use when writing - or reading the commit-graph file. If version 1 is specified, then - the corrected commit dates will not be written or read. Defaults to - 2. - -commitGraph.maxNewFilters:: - Specifies the default value for the `--max-new-filters` option of `git - commit-graph write` (c.f., linkgit:git-commit-graph[1]). - -commitGraph.readChangedPaths:: - Deprecated. Equivalent to commitGraph.changedPathsVersion=-1 if true, and - commitGraph.changedPathsVersion=0 if false. (If commitGraph.changedPathVersion - is also set, commitGraph.changedPathsVersion takes precedence.) - -commitGraph.changedPathsVersion:: - Specifies the version of the changed-path Bloom filters that Git will read and - write. May be -1, 0, 1, or 2. Note that values greater than 1 may be - incompatible with older versions of Git which do not yet understand - those versions. Use caution when operating in a mixed-version - environment. -+ -Defaults to -1. -+ -If -1, Git will use the version of the changed-path Bloom filters in the -repository, defaulting to 1 if there are none. -+ -If 0, Git will not read any Bloom filters, and will write version 1 Bloom -filters when instructed to write. -+ -If 1, Git will only read version 1 Bloom filters, and will write version 1 -Bloom filters. -+ -If 2, Git will only read version 2 Bloom filters, and will write version 2 -Bloom filters. -+ -See linkgit:git-commit-graph[1] for more information. |
